shoelace
shoe·lace S0356100 (sho͞o′lās′)n. A string or cord used for lacing and fastening shoes. Also called shoestring.shoelace (ˈʃuːˌleɪs) n (Clothing & Fashion) a cord or lace for fastening shoesshoe•lace (ˈʃuˌleɪs) n. a string or lace for fastening a shoe.
